March 11, 2024 - Fort Wayne Parks and Recreation adds two shows to its lineup at the Foellinger Theatre. Honeywell Arts & Entertainment presents Rockin' the 80's: Great White, Slaughter & Vixen on Friday, August 2, 2024, and TESLA on Wednesday, September 25, 2024, at the Foellinger Theatre. Tickets go on sale Friday, March 15, at 10:00 a.m. and will be available online at ticketmaster.com or in person at the Parks and Recreation Department, 705 East State Blvd.

TESLA – Wednesday, September 25, at 7:30 p.m.

TESLA's bluesy, soulful sound is strongly embedded in the roots of organic and authentic 1970s rock and roll. Their 1986 platinum debut album Mechanical Resonance, included Top 40 hits "Modern Day Cowboy" and "Little Suzi." The band continues to record and release material, including nine new albums since 2000, and recently debuted their new single, "Time To Rock!" Fans will be able to sing along to the group's early 90's classic hits like "Love Song," "Signs," and "What You Give." TESLA is a celebration of the greatest spirits of rock and roll.
